精易论坛
标题: c#对比易语言真香 [打印本页]
作者: 1026360899 时间: 2025-4-13 19:29
标题: c#对比易语言真香
最近学了c#,同样的功能,感觉快了好多
比如近期做的一个画图功能,用易语言+内存画板,总是崩溃而且找不到原因,另外速度也慢,用c#实现后速度快了10倍以上,而且c#崩亏的话找bug也好找
总的来说目前c对我来说优势如下:
1,各种资源包多,而且稳定
2,速度快,性能强
3,用vs2022开发特别智能,很多时候写个注释,系统就自动提示出了正确代码,省时又省力
4,不会写的时候可以直接问ai,但是易语言这块哪怕是问deepseek,有时候感觉它也是胡说八道
不友好的地方就是英语不好,很难记
比如易语言模块的命令,文本_取出中间文本(),一次就记住了,并且知道下次怎么写了
但是c#的命令,可能这次用了,知道了有这个命令,但是下次有想不起来怎么写了,需要查一下
另外c#的函数解释由于很多都是英文的,看着也有点费劲
大家觉得对于英语不好的人,学c#要怎么学比较好呢
作者: domingo 时间: 2025-4-13 19:39
其实可以自己弄个博客,用来记录各种翻译好的方法名!
可以以精易模块常用的方法名,自己整个类似C#函数方法,然后备注成比如文本_取出中间文本,用来查找和说明。
下次需要用的时候,直接检索出来,再复制到C#里面,我反正学python就这么干!
作者: Behavior 时间: 2025-4-13 19:48
自己写个类 用中文写 下次 加载类就行,或者写个dll
作者: 谈谈的味道 时间: 2025-4-13 19:53
各种反编译
作者: 雨落无声 时间: 2025-4-13 20:01
编程常用的单词就哪些!多练手多敲代码就记住了!
作者: CaringGuy 时间: 2025-4-13 20:03
C#还行,就是弄NET环境比较麻烦,旧系统(WIN7)未安装运行库的可能无法直接运行
作者: 元老 时间: 2025-4-13 20:04
买一本维克多5500,大概5个月就都能背完,高三亲测
作者: xboy 时间: 2025-4-13 20:09
学吧,学完CSharp学winform/WPF/UWP/MAUI/Blazor/WinUI/Avalonia/ASP.NET没啥捷径,自己慢慢记笔记,记思维导图,不知不觉自己都累计写了20W字WORD文档...多看官方文档,多看教程...额,好像说的都是废话,如果英语不好,看官方文档可以选择中文文档,但是CSharp的中文文档有这么些个缺点
中文文档有时左侧缺少对应大纲,例如
https://learn.microsoft.com/zh-cn/dotnet/standard/collections/thread-safe/
https://learn.microsoft.com/en-us/dotnet/standard/collections/thread-safe/
有些中文文档也是英文页面,例如
https://learn.microsoft.com/zh-cn/dotnet/api/system.threading.tasks.taskstatus
有些中文文档里表格里关于属性介绍,里面的关键字被翻译成了中文,例如:
https://learn.microsoft.com/zh-cn/dotnet/standard/base-types/common-type-system
还有些翻译会让人误解,例如:
原单词 | | |
Exceptions | | |
Attributes | | |
Key | | |
iIteration | | |
Timers | | |
Inheritance | | |
Value | | |
Task | | |
解决办法,只看英文文档,可以用chrome谷歌浏览器插件-沉浸式翻译,选择双语翻译,这样中英对照着看
最好的办法还是把Csharp中常用的属性/方法/类名/语句死记硬背,也只能这样了,真没有什么好的办法,其实多敲敲代码也能记住大概意思,国内的CSharp中文教学文档跟不上CSharp的更新速度
学CSharp唯一缺点就是找小型的示例代码比较困难,不像易语言,在精易论坛能找到几万个小型代码,例如:超级列表框使用示例/基于winAPI的窗口创建等等,网上找这种小型示例代码比较困难,在github上找搜关键词有时老搜不准
作者: 1026360899 时间: 2025-4-13 20:37
优秀啊
作者: 1026360899 时间: 2025-4-13 20:37
Task你不说异步 我就直接理解成线程了
作者: wjlzhi 时间: 2025-4-13 21:01
我觉得用EXCEL表格记录更方便搜索。加个表头筛选。搜索文本两个字,包含文本两个字的都列出来了。
作者: 心缘电脑 时间: 2025-4-13 21:21
我感觉用33号的膨胀螺丝配华龙的方便面真的是美味
作者: 心理疾病患者 时间: 2025-4-13 21:30
都c#直接AI写代码呗
作者: 1026360899 时间: 2025-4-13 22:37
ai写代码道基不问 日后无法成就大道
作者: 1026360899 时间: 2025-4-13 22:37
搭配混泥土
作者: 暴龙战士 时间: 2025-4-13 23:34
c#是真的简单,缺点就是写出来的软件太容易被破J了
作者: 1486688956 时间: 2025-4-14 00:56



作者: 嫂子 时间: 2025-4-14 01:17
等你开源了 就知道了苦了
作者: 嫂子 时间: 2025-4-14 01:58
漫是因为你代码的问题。圆角大家都是GDI+ 不存在快慢问题。
作者: 笨来无一悟 时间: 2025-4-14 03:21
缺点就是发布既源码
作者: 1026360899 时间: 2025-4-14 10:25
有办法加壳么
作者: 1026360899 时间: 2025-4-14 10:26
有办法加壳吗
作者: asd1324500251 时间: 2025-4-14 11:03
只能加混淆,但是还是容易被破J
作者: 暴龙战士 时间: 2025-4-15 21:02
可以加混淆,但是破J难度还是太低了。
欢迎光临 精易论坛 (https://125.confly.eu.org/) |
Powered by Discuz! X3.4 |